首页 > 代码库 > cd命令

cd命令

cd==change directory (更改目录)

whoami  (查看当前用户名字)

id  (查看uid. gid以及组)

echo $HOME ==cd (查看用户家目录)   $HOME(系统自带的环境变量)

pwd  (查看当前用户在那个目录下)

cd (进入用户的家目录)

cd -   (进入上次所在的目录)

cd ~   (~ 表示当前用户的家目录)

cd /var/log/  (进入到指定的目录下)

cd. (当前目录)

cd. .(上一级目录)

cd(change directory)这个命令是用来变更用户所在的目录的,后面如果什么都不跟,就会直接到当前目录的根目录下,我们试验用的是root账户,所以运行cd后,会进入root账户的根目录 /root后面跟目录名,则会切换到指定的目录下

[root@qiangge local]# cd /tmp/

[root@qiangge tmp]# pwd

/tmp

[root@qiangge tmp]# cd

[root@qiangge ~]# pwd

/root

pwd这个命令打印当前所在的目录

cd后面只能跟目录名,而不能是文件名,如果跟了文件名会报错:

[root@qiangge ~]# cd /etc/passwd

-bash: cd: /etc/passwd: 不是目录

下面我们介绍两种用法,

./表示当前目录

../表示当前目录的上一级目录:

[root@qiangge ~]# cd /usr/local/lib

[root@qiangge lib]# pwd

/usr/local/lib

[root@qiangge lib]# cd .

[root@qiangge lib]# pwd

/usr/local/lib

[root@qiangge lib]# cd ..

[root@qiangge local]# pwd

/usr/local

下例中的

~ 表示用户的家目录

- 表示上一次所在的目录。(cd -交替;相当于电视遥控器的“返回键”)

[root@qiangge local]# cd ~

[root@qiangge ~]# pwd

/root

[root@qiangge ~]# cd -

/usr/local

[root@qiangge local]# pwd

/usr/local


本文出自 “12350027” 博客,谢绝转载!

cd命令